首页 新闻 会员 周边 捐助

ComboBox显示数据库内容并改变

0
悬赏园豆:20 [已关闭问题]

在form中的构造中已经在VIEW中显示初恋,现在要做的是在ComboBox显示数据库第一行的所有内容,并在选择相当内容后在VIEW能显示相关内容,

 public Form1()
        {
            InitializeComponent();
        

            Querys q = new Querys();
            string sqlx = "time";
            //如果发生改变,从ComboBOX获取改变值,改变
            string sqly = "svcount";
            DataTable dt = new DataTable();
            int[] x = new int[70];
            DateTime[] y=new DateTime[70];
          
            int n = 0;
          
            dt=q.Query(sqlx,500);

            for (int i = 0; i <70; i++)
            {

                 y[i] = (DateTime)dt.Rows[i][n];
              
            }
            //Y轴改变,判断datatable中的字段名

            dt = q.Query(sqly, 500);
            for (int i = 0; i < 70; i++)
            {
                x[i] = (int)dt.Rows[i][0];
            }                    
                                //(纵坐标,横坐标)
            LinePlot line3 = new LinePlot(x, y);
            plotSurface.Add(line3);
        }
        /*        
         *
         * 将是数据库中第一行所有内容在ComboBox中下拉显示
         */
        private void Form1_Load(object sender, EventArgs e)
        {
            string sql = "*";
            Querys q = new Querys();
            DataTable dt = q.Query(sql, 500);

            selectup.DataSource = dt;

           

        }
     
        private void select_SelectedIndexChanged(object sender, EventArgs e)
        {
        }
     

云蹄麒麟的主页 云蹄麒麟 | 初学一级 | 园豆:180
提问于:2009-02-20 16:48
< >
分享
清除回答草稿
   您需要登录以后才能回答,未注册用户请先注册